Wis.-Green Bay defeats Youngstown State 69-55

Jan 24, 2010 - 10:22 PM YOUNGSTOWN, Ohio(AP) -- Troy Cotton scored 23 points and Wisconsin-Green Bay defeated Youngstown State 69-55 on Sunday.

The Phoenix (15-7, 7-3 Horizon League) scored 25 points off 16 turnovers, and led by as many as 18. Cotton's 3-pointer gave Wisconsin-Green Bay a 69-51 advantage with 2:04 remaining.

Cotton hit a career-high 7 of 12 3-pointers, and moved past Ryan Tillema for second place on Wisconsin-Green Bay's career 3-pointers list with 234.

The Penguins (7-12, 2-8) cut the lead to 50-44 on Dan Boudler's layup with 10:38 remaining. But they went without a field goal for 8 minutes, and missed 12 of their final 19 free throw attempts.

Randy Berry's free throw capped the 16-5 run and Wisconsin-Green Bay led 66-49 with 2:56 left.

DeAndre Mays and Kelvin Bright scored 10 points apiece for Youngstown State, which lost its fourth straight.
